FX06 LWW is a 2006 Suzuki AN400 in Grey with a 385c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2006 Suzuki AN400 models, the average MOT pass rate is 86.9% with a typical mileage of 15,168 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Suzuki AN400 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 563 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FX06 LWW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ki AN400 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 20 years old, this Suzuki AN400 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
